¶ Understanding Customer Insights in SAP C4C
Customer insights refer to the comprehensive understanding of customer preferences, behaviors, and interactions derived from data collected across multiple touchpoints. SAP C4C aggregates data from sales, service, marketing, and social channels to build a 360-degree customer profile.
- Unified Customer View: Consolidates customer information from various sources for a holistic perspective.
- Segmentation: Enables grouping of customers based on demographics, behavior, and purchase history.
- Sentiment Analysis: Integrates social media and feedback data to gauge customer sentiment and satisfaction.
Predictive analytics uses historical data, statistical algorithms, and machine learning to forecast future outcomes. In SAP C4C, predictive analytics can be applied to:
- Lead Scoring: Prioritize leads based on their likelihood to convert.
- Churn Prediction: Identify customers at risk of attrition and proactively engage them.
- Sales Forecasting: Anticipate sales trends and optimize inventory and resource planning.
- Next Best Action: Recommend personalized offers or service actions to maximize customer lifetime value.
SAP C4C integrates embedded machine learning models that automatically analyze patterns in customer data and generate predictive scores and recommendations.
Combining SAP C4C with SAP Analytics Cloud expands predictive capabilities, offering advanced modeling, visualization, and scenario planning tools.
Real-time data processing allows immediate insights and timely decision-making, enabling dynamic customer interactions.
¶ Best Practices for Implementing Customer Insights and Predictive Analytics
- Data Quality Assurance: Maintain clean, accurate, and comprehensive customer data to ensure reliable analytics.
- Define Clear Objectives: Focus predictive analytics on specific business goals such as improving retention or increasing upsell.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Align sales, marketing, and service teams to act on insights cohesively.
- Continuous Model Training: Regularly update machine learning models with new data to maintain prediction accuracy.
- Privacy Compliance: Ensure data usage complies with regulations like GDPR and respects customer consent preferences.
